Watch the Original Schoolhouse Rock Composers Sing “Conjunction Junction” and “I’m Just a Bill” Live in Concert

In an interview with the director of the Fillius Jazz Archive at Hamilton College, Sheldon agreed that the series owed a major debt to jazz:

When we made Conjunction Junction, it was me and Teddy Edwards and Nick Ceroli and Leroy Vinegar and Bob Dorough played the piano. That’s a jazz band…it was really nothing to do with rock. It was always jazz, but we said rock and roll, so everybody loved it for rock and roll.

A double bass can be a lovely solo instrument. I am accompanying a performer on the 2nd movement of Serge Koussevitzky's double bass concerto (the first half of the video below). It is a lovely piece to work up. Luckily, it is not too difficult to learn that part in 2 weeks.



So yesterday between the normal Sunday service and a rehearsal for next week, I played various hymns (including St. Patrick's Breastplate), Mendelssohn, Charpentier, Koussevitzky, and a gospel song with the choir. Just a little diverse (in the past I have had Tallis, Anglican Chant, and a gospel anthem on the same service).

If you haven't heard, The Girl From Ipanema, Astrud Gilberto, died this week. She was the sound of Samba and introduced millions to the music from Brazil. The Girl from Ipanema became immortal.



She had other hits that didn't go far in the US, but were applauded elsewhere.



I often mixed her and Elis Regina up. Loved them both.
